Transaction 3d43ba4a64d2078514be1637abc77faffc3015d54ea7a152f0c6a98067982245

1 Input
2 Outputs
  • 3d43ba4a64d2078514be1637abc77faffc3015d54ea7a152f0c6a98067982245:0
  • value  5654
    address  18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
  • 3d43ba4a64d2078514be1637abc77faffc3015d54ea7a152f0c6a98067982245:1
  • value  559793
    address  3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X